Regarding loans with savings accounts, we can say that unfortunately it is not possible to use a savings account to take out a loan from Caixa, for example, to have a checkbook. Furthermore, in this type of bank account there is no overdraft limit. Therefore, this means that it is only possible to use the maximum balance in the account.
However, it is important to say that Personal Credit or personal loans are recommended for those seeking money without needing to prove their purpose. …
One of the advantages of Personal Credit is that it is quick and easy to apply for, with payment in installments that fit your budget, via direct debit, bank slip or post-dated check.

After all, what do you need to take out a personal loan at Caixa?
This part here is no longer so bureaucratic, what you basically need is the mandatory data for any financial transaction:
The documents required to take out a loan at Caixa are.
CPF.
ID.
Proof of residence.
Proof of income.
